  • Title

    Applying temporal reasoning to cardiac electrophysiology

  • Abstract
    Models of the function of the heart are constructed. The various anatomical regions of the heart muscle pass through electrical states. Each region may be in each state for a different amount of time. The application of temporal constraints to the model of the heart is investigated. Two main approaches, one quantitative and one qualitative, are taken, The work is based on the Ticker model of N. Gotts et al. (1989)
